Two arrested in Chennai’s Thiruvanmiyur for hoarding 40 LPG cylinders for sale in blackmarket amid price hike | Chennai News

Chennai: Two men, who hoarded 40 commercial and domestic LPG cylinders intended for sale in the black market, were arrested from a house on Chithirai Kulam Street in Thiruvanmiyur on Friday evening.Police identified the suspects as Neelamegam, 78, and his son Kumar, 41.
